Transaction 03d1d61caa59df80cefbe7b58dd5443d25466f3eb7ee8d9511c91466c65ae7b2

1 Input
2 Outputs
  • 03d1d61caa59df80cefbe7b58dd5443d25466f3eb7ee8d9511c91466c65ae7b2:0
  • value  5220569
    address  14EgFgAt2HcMpTVhtfUnvzHcyXvUqLYWcV
  • 03d1d61caa59df80cefbe7b58dd5443d25466f3eb7ee8d9511c91466c65ae7b2:1
  • value  4678185343
    address  366Dgw4pi3rnvu5zizVWZF6nijWxZWc6RA